It is official, the refurbished Galaxy Note 7, branded “Galaxy Note 7R”, is going on sale. The date has not been confirmed yet but we do have our estimates which are some time in June.

The Galaxy Note 7R just got a safety certification from the US Federal Communications Commission, which could potentially see the device make its way to the US.

According to leaked images and information, the Note 7R is expected to sport a 3200 mAh battery and run on Android 7.0 Nougat. The original Note 7 featured a 3,500 mAh battery and run Android 6.0.1 Marshmallow.

However, the big news is that the Note 7R could cost as low as 400 dollars.

A Samsung official was quoted by The Investor saying,“We have not yet decided on the phone’s launch schedule. We plan to launch the phone before the Galaxy Note 8 that comes out later this year.”

This statement also puts to bed the doubts that people had regarding whether Samsung would make a Note device this year, it’s coming!

The original Note 7 was released in August of 2016. I will not hold my breath for a similar release window for the Note 8, seeing how the Galaxy S8 was slightly delayed, but it is good to know that Samsung’s money machine (the note series) is very much functional.

We asked Samsung Electronics East Africa whether the Note 7R would make its way to the Kenyan market and unfortunately the answer was no.
